Add Active by Ali Reza Vojdanitalab was in 2005. Again like New Wave amongst others, it is a Sound Generator, developed for the Atari ST series. With Add Active you create your own 16-bit sounds using additive synthesis for generating waveforms. It provides 130 sine waves, plus a Saw and Square oscilliators. Sounds can be sent via MIDI SDS to your Sampler. Also, Add Active includes a programme called ATAreSYNTH which uses resynthesis, allowing analysis of 16-bit raw audio, to return an Add Active spectrum file which can be loaded in Add Active.

Overview
- Name: Add Active
- Type: Sound Generator
- Sample Format: 16 bits
- Sample Rate: 44.1 kHz
- Sound Quality: Mono
- Hardware ADC: N/A
- ADC Connection Type: N/A
